- Q: What are the benefits of using ChooMee SoftSip Food Pouch Tops? A: ChooMee SoftSip Food Pouch Tops offer flow control to prevent spills and allow babies to manage their food intake. The soft silicone valve is gentle on tender gums, making it ideal for teething babies and promoting baby-led feeding.
- Q: Are the materials used in ChooMee SoftSip Food Pouch Tops safe for my baby? A: Yes, ChooMee SoftSip Food Pouch Tops are made from 100% silicone that is BPA, PVC, Lead, and Phthalate free, meeting all US and European safety standards.
- Q: How do I attach the SoftSip top to a food pouch? A: To attach the SoftSip top, securely push and twist it onto the pouch spout until you hear a click into the plastic groove. Then, pinch and gently pull the valve top to open it.
- Q: Can I clean the ChooMee SoftSip Food Pouch Tops in the dishwasher? A: Yes, the SoftSip tops are dishwasher safe, making them easy to clean after use. They are also safe for freezer and boiling.
- Q: Will the SoftSip top fit all food pouches? A: The SoftSip top is designed to fit the majority of store-bought and reusable food pouches, ensuring versatility in use.
- Q: How does the flow control feature work? A: The flow control feature allows parents to adjust the flow rate of the food by pinching the valve top, giving babies control over how much they consume at a time.
- Q: Is there a travel case included with the SoftSip tops? A: Yes, the ChooMee SoftSip Food Pouch Tops come with a travel case for convenient on-the-go storage.
- Q: What makes the SoftSip top different from regular pouch tops? A: Unlike regular pouch tops, the SoftSip top has a soft silicone valve that provides flow control, preventing spills and making feeding easier and cleaner for both babies and parents.
- Q: Can teething babies use the SoftSip top safely? A: Yes, the SoftSip top is made from durable silicone that is safe for teething babies to chew on, providing comfort while they feed.
- Q: What is the best way to store the SoftSip tops when not in use? A: When not in use, store the SoftSip tops in the included travel case, or use the airtight cap for safe refrigerator storage.
